Lagos government shuts down Chrisland Schools


According to a news report by the Punch, the Lagos State government has closed down Chrisland Schools in Lekki, Lagos State, indefinitely over the recent immoral video involving a 10-year-old pupil.

It was gathered that some of the students of the school engaged in immoral acts during a trip to Dubai to participate in the World School Games.

The news of the indefinite shut down of the school was contained in a press statement released by the Lagos State government on Monday.

The government said, “In the meantime, all Chrisland schools within Lagos State are hereby closed, pending further investigations."

The Punch also reported that pupils from the elite private school located in Victoria Garden City had been suspended indefinitely, especially the 10-year-old girl, since she was a "major actor" in the "immoral act."

But the mother of the young lad released an 11-minute video claiming that her daughter was drugged and raped by some male students at the school.

The Lagos State government added that the matter is currently being investigated.
